Product Description:
1,3-Diiodoazulene is primarily utilized in organic synthesis and material science due to its unique structure and reactivity. It serves as a key intermediate in the preparation of various azulene derivatives, which are valued for their optical and electronic properties. This compound is particularly useful in the development of organic semiconductors and photoconductive materials, where its ability to undergo further functionalization allows for the tuning of material properties. Additionally, 1,3-diiodoazulene finds application in the synthesis of dyes and pigments, leveraging its vibrant color and stability. Its role in the creation of novel organic compounds for advanced materials underscores its importance in research and industrial applications.
